'Real Housewives of New Jersey' star Teresa Giudice reveals Melissa Gorga wasn't first woman Joe Gorga got engaged to, calls him 'Runaway Groom'

The first two engagements ended on a bitter note, which was why Teresa Giudice and her mother decided to stay quiet for the third one.
PUBLISHED NOV 21, 2019

What is reality TV without some juicy gossip and drama? During a session with Stir the Pot with Teresa & Dolores panel at BravoCon 'Real Housewives of New Jersey' star Teresa Giudice revealed Melissa Gorga wasn't the first woman in Joe Gorga's (Giudice''s brother) life, he was engaged twice before.

"Melissa moved into his house a month after she met him; they got engaged in four, five months. Everything happened in 10 months. But it was his third engagement. Me and my mother kept our mouth shut. We were like, 'You know what, let him marry this one,'" she told AOL's Gibson Johns.

The first two engagements ended on a bitter note, which was why Giudice and her mother decided to stay quiet for the third one. Gorga date his 16-year-old girlfriend for a decade and broke up eight months before they are scheduled to get married.

"The second [fiancée], [she] treated us like s--t at the bridal shower. I told my brother. He broke up with her a week later," said Giudice, adding that she couldn't be happier for the couple and thought he picked "the right one" this time.

Though Giudice has the nicest compliments for Gorga (Melissa), their relationship on the show didn't hit off on the right note. Their complicated equation stemmed from the fact that Giudice's family entered the show without discussing it with her first. But that doesn't mean they are waiting to have a go at each other or get into a spat. "I'm good with her. But we are different," Giudice said.

Interestingly, the family was able to set aside their differences and travel to Italy to spend quality time with each other. "We were just there to enjoy each other’s times and you know, lots of laughs and lots of tears. Just reacquainting with each other, it was pretty amazing. We had the best time ever. It was so good," she said during an interview with 'Good Morning America'.
